1. Understand the Nature of Cryptocurrency Volatility
Cryptocurrencies are inherently volatile due to several factors:

Market Sentiment : News, social media trends, and macroeconomic events can drastically influence prices.
Regulatory Changes : Government policies and regulations can create sudden market shifts.
Liquidity Differences : Smaller or newer cryptocurrencies often experience more extreme price swings compared to established ones like Bitcoin or Ethereum.
Understanding that volatility is a core characteristic of crypto markets will help you set realistic expectations and avoid emotional decision-making.

4. Develop a Trading Strategy
A well-defined strategy helps you stay focused and reduces impulsive decisions. Consider these popular approaches:

Day Trading
Buy and sell within the same day to capitalize on short-term price movements.
Requires constant monitoring and quick decision-making.
Swing Trading
Hold positions for days or weeks to benefit from medium-term trends.
Ideal for those who don’t have time for full-time trading.
HODLing (Long-Term Investment)
Invest in fundamentally strong projects and hold them for years.
Best suited for risk-tolerant individuals with a long-term vision.
Arbitrage
Exploit price differences between exchanges to make profits.
Requires technical expertise and fast execution.
Scalping
Make multiple small trades throughout the day to capture minor price fluctuations.
High-risk, high-reward approach requiring precision.
Regardless of your chosen strategy, always backtest it using historical data before committing real funds.

5. Manage Risk Effectively
Risk management is crucial in such a volatile market. Follow these principles:

Set Stop-Loss Orders : Automatically sell assets when they reach a predetermined price to limit losses.
Diversify Your Portfolio : Avoid putting all your capital into a single cryptocurrency; spread investments across different assets.
Position Sizing : Never risk more than 1-2% of your total capital on a single trade.
Avoid Leverage Unless Experienced : Margin trading amplifies both gains and losses, so proceed with caution.
Remember: Preservation of capital should always take precedence over chasing profits.

7. Be Mindful of Tax Implications
Cryptocurrency transactions may be subject to taxation depending on your jurisdiction:

Capital Gains Tax : Profits from selling cryptocurrencies are often taxable.
Income Tax : Earnings from mining, staking, or receiving tokens as payment may also incur taxes.
Record Keeping : Maintain detailed records of all trades, including dates, amounts, and prices, to simplify tax reporting.
Consult a tax professional familiar with cryptocurrency regulations to ensure compliance.

9. Beware of Scams and Fraud
The decentralized nature of cryptocurrencies makes them attractive targets for scammers:

Phishing Attacks : Fake emails or websites may attempt to steal your login credentials.
Ponzi Schemes : Promises of guaranteed returns are usually too good to be true.
Fake ICOs/IEOs : Conduct thorough research before investing in new projects.
Exit Scams : Developers abandon projects after raising funds, leaving investors with worthless tokens.
Always verify the legitimacy of platforms, teams, and projects before engaging.
